An Upper and Lower Solution Approach to Singular Second Order Ordinary Differential Equations with Nonlinear Boundary Conditions

Abstract:Using an upper and lower approach, this paper establishes the existence of positive solutions for singular second order boundary value problems of the form (py'Y + p(t)q(t)f(t,y,py') = 0,0 < t < 1, where f(t,y,z) is singular at y = 0 and z = 0.
Keywords:Singular boundary value problem  Nonlinear boundary condition  Schauder fixed point theorem  An upper and lower approach
